技术文摘
css的后代选择器有哪些
CSS的后代选择器有哪些
在网页设计与开发中,CSS(层叠样式表)起着至关重要的作用,它能让网页的样式更加美观和吸引人。其中,后代选择器是CSS中常用且强大的选择器类型之一,合理运用后代选择器可以精准地对网页元素进行样式设置。
后代选择器是用于选择某个元素的所有后代元素的选择器。它的语法形式为:祖先元素 后代元素。这里的“ ”代表空格,用来分隔祖先元素和后代元素。通过这种方式,可以定位到特定元素下的子孙元素,并应用相应的样式。
在CSS中,最基本的后代选择器就是普通元素选择器作为祖先和后代。例如,body p 表示选择 <body> 元素内的所有 <p> 元素。这在实际应用中非常有用,比如当你想对整个网页内的段落文本设置统一的字体、颜色或行间距时,就可以使用这个选择器。
除了普通元素,类选择器和ID选择器也能作为后代选择器的组成部分。例如,.parent.child,这里的 .parent 是一个类选择器,代表具有 parent 类的元素,而 .child 是具有 child 类的元素。这个选择器会选择所有 parent 类元素下的 child 类元素。ID选择器也类似,#main #sub,会选择ID为 main 的元素下ID为 sub 的元素。
属性选择器也可以融入后代选择器中。例如,[role="navigation"] a,它会选择所有具有 role="navigation" 属性的元素内的 <a> 元素,常用于导航栏样式的设置。
了解和熟练运用CSS的后代选择器,能极大地提高网页样式设计的效率和准确性。通过精准定位不同层次结构中的元素,为每个元素赋予独特的样式,打造出视觉效果良好且结构清晰的网页。无论是小型个人网站还是大型商业平台,后代选择器都在网页样式设计中扮演着不可或缺的角色,是前端开发者必须掌握的重要技能之一。
- JDK 15:Java 15 的全新功能
- 一文彻底搞懂面试常问的微服务
- 怎样编写简洁的 CQRS 代码
- 谷歌 2020 年 5 月核心算法更新 众多网站将受影响
- 我终究从 Chrome 转投 Firefox
- 2020 年 React 开发人员的 22 种神奇工具
- 在 Vue 里怎样把函数作为 props 传递给组件
- Python 面试:53 道题考验软件工程师
- 仅用小 200 行 Python 代码即可实现换脸程序,厉害!
- 全球 Python 调查报告:Python 2 渐趋消亡,PyCharm 比 VS Code 更受青睐
- 善用 Elasticsearch,早下班不是梦!
- 史上超全的 JavaScript 模块化方案与工具
- 5 款酷炫的 Python 工具
- 五个 JavaScript 字符串处理库
- 为何 Java 多线程启动调用 start() 方法而非 run() 方法